Interpretation

The lyrics of the song "Days Before Rodeo: the Prayer" by Travis Scott are about his thoughts and feelings in his life as a successful musician. He describes his impatience despite his success and how he still deals with the same habits like drinking alcohol and smoking cigarettes.
